The word "un-veiling" means to reveal or make known something that was previously hidden or unknown. There are several synonyms for this word that can be used interchangeably, depending on the context of the situation. Some alternatives to "un-veiling" include disclosing, uncovering, unveiling, displaying, exposing, and discovering. Each of these words has a slightly different connotation, with "disclosing" suggesting a deliberate act of sharing information, "uncovering" implying the removal of a cover or layer, and "discovering" indicating the revelation of something new or previously unknown. Overall, these synonyms can add variety and nuance to writing or conversation, depending on the desired impact.

What are the opposite words for un-veiling?

The word "unveiling" is commonly used to describe the act of revealing or making something known to others. However, there are several antonyms for the word that convey the opposite meaning. One such antonym is concealing, which refers to hiding or keeping something secret. Another antonym is obscuring, which means to make something unclear or difficult to understand. Conversely, obfuscating is a more extreme antonym that describes intentionally confusing or misleading others. Finally, if one wants to avoid revealing something altogether, they may choose to suppress or burry it, completing the list of antonyms for the word "unveiling".
